    About Hilde Wildlife Studio

    Hilde Wildlife Studio is a taxidermy studio located in Village of Clarkston, Michigan, with a long history of producing high-end wildlife mounts for hunters and collectors from around the world.

    They focus on preserving trophies from North American, African, Asian, European, and other exotic hunts, and guide you from initial shipping logistics through to display in your game room.

    Their primary focus is full-service big game and safari taxidermy, including shoulder, life-size, European, antler, bird, and rug work.

    Animal Mount Details

    The studio works on a wide range of big game, small game, birds, fish, and exotic species from North America and international destinations.

    You can choose from shoulder mounts, full-body mounts, European/skull mounts, antler mounts, bird mounts, rugs, and restoration options.

    With roots going back nearly 100 years to Al Hilde’s original Detroit shop and continuous operation in Clarkston since 1971 under the Taylor family, Hilde Wildlife Studio brings deep experience and long-running taxidermy innovation.

    Reviews and the studio’s own positioning emphasize award-winning, highly realistic wildlife art that holds its quality and appeal for many years.


    Pricing & Turnaround

    They publish detailed price lists by region and species, with example pricing such as deer European mounts around 195, all-species deer shoulder mounts around 750, life-size deer around 3900, elk shoulder mounts around 1340, moose shoulder mounts around 1570, bird mounts in the mid-300s, rugs such as bear at 210 per linear foot, and many services marked as “& up” or by quote depending on complexity.

    Additional charges apply for services like skinning and fleshing by the hour, antler staining, peg antlers, broken point repair, and skull cleaning and bleaching, and they encourage you to call for estimates on repairs and certain African or specialty work; reviews mention quick or “nice” turnaround times and no complaints about delays.

    They also offer rugs, skull cleaning and bleaching, restoration and cleaning of existing mounts, habitat-style display bases, and assistance with importing trophies and planning safaris or hunts, including federally authorized trophy imports.
